GMC Kolhapur MBBS NEET UG Cutoff 2024

GMC Kolhapur NEET UG Cutoff 2024 has been released for admission to the MBBS program. GMC Kolhapur MBBS NEET UG cutoff 2024 for general category candidates are given in the table below:

CoursesNEET UG Cutoff 2024
MBBS11177 (Closing Rank)

GMC Kolhapur MD NEET PG Cutoff 2024

GMC Kolhapur NEET PG Cutoff 2024 has been released for admission to the MD program. GMC Kolhapur MD NEET PG cutoff 2024 for general category candidates are given in the table below:

CoursesNEET PG Cutoff 2024
MD in General Medicine1000-2000 (Rank)
MD in Paediatrics2000-3000 (Rank)
MD in Pathology8000-10000 (Rank)
MD in Anaesthesiology6000-8000 (Rank)
MD in Community Medicine10000-12000 (Rank)

GMC Kolhapur MS NEET PG Cutoff 2024

GMC Kolhapur NEET PG Cutoff 2024 has been released for admission to the MS program. GMC Kolhapur MS NEET PG cutoff 2024 for general category candidates are given in the table below:

CoursesNEET PG Cutoff 2024
MS in General Surgery2000-3000 (Rank)
MS in Obstetrics & Gynaecology3000-4000 (Rank)
MS in Ophthalmology5000-6000 (Rank)
